In order to separate the figure from the whole piece, my first task was to remove very carefully the overlapping leafy elements and the goldwork frame. To do this, I snipped threads from the back of the whole piece and picked them out bit by bit with tweezers, folding back the overlapping parts of the design to expose the figure and see how far I had to snip things to uncover it. Deep down inside, I had hoped that I could salvage even the parts of the figure that were stitched over with the surrounding decorative elements. Once I had all the overlapping elements released, I folded those back out of the way to assess the damage to the figure. It’s not all that bad in the scheme of things, but the holes are still pretty evident, so this area will definitely need to be covered with a new frame. Notice the difference in the colors of blue between the exposed figure and the part of the figure that was covered with the goldwork frame! It makes the exposed figure look pretty dingy...
